I'm currently configuring my Dell Dimension 4100 to be able to run DOS games and see what I get. The OS I'm running is Windows 98SE with Service Pack 3.33 installed. The problem is that upper memory reserved is very limited especially when turning EMS on which I REALLY want. So, I've used the monochrome memory block, which is I=B000-B7FF, to get the least of the memory since it's never used at all on a machine like this. And with this, I can do DOS just fine, but Windows 98SE refuses to load normally (Was able to get into safe mode). I've tried other memory blocks, used HIGHSCAN, used FRAME=C800, and changed video cards, but to no avail. Any suggestions?
